
High-speed 12-bit Analog-to-Digital Converter (ADC) featuring a single-ended input and parallel interface. Achieves 1 LSB Integral Nonlinearity (INL) and Differential Nonlinearity (DNL). Offers a sampling rate of 333 kSPS with a full-scale error of 8 LSB. This unipolar device is housed in a SOIC package for surface mounting, with tin-matte contact plating. Operates within a temperature range of -40°C to 85°C and consumes a maximum of 100mW.
